Dozens of moons, thousands of asteroids and billions of comets, the family of the sun. Only four light hours from Earth is the planet Neptune, and its giant satellite, Triton. Even in the outskirts of our own solar system, we humans have barely begun our explorations. Only a century ago we were ignorant even of the existence of the planet Pluto. Its moon Charon, remained undiscovered till 1978. The rings of Uranus were first detected in 1977. There are new worlds to chart even this close to home. Saturn is a giant gas world. If it has a solid surface it must lie far below the clouds we see. Saturn's majestic rings are made of trillions of orbiting snowballs.
